Output 9aa8c3ff8ff7651f142b6689db6599af8bcbc06e18eae46bbdea61e02909fcf7:7

value
58621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af44cabe0b869fc8ba1d99faa89a98f4575c994 OP_EQUAL
address
3P7LhfAH3jsg44SrsgyUEcMFBVQ2Jpv1po
transaction
9aa8c3ff8ff7651f142b6689db6599af8bcbc06e18eae46bbdea61e02909fcf7
confirmations
26341
spent
true